Aslan Technologies has a manufacturing/fabrication position available for a person who will construct/assemble equipment for water/wastewater treatment, chemical dosing and metering systems; This position requires a candidate who can work primarily at jobsites that may be outdoors and in all weather conditions. These remote jobsites are typically within 3 hours of our shop located in Burlington but may be further on occasion.
Duties and Responsibilities
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
- Mechanically and electrically hook up equipment in Aslan's test area
- Accurately and to a high level of quality assemble threaded and solvent welded PVC/CPVC pipe spools including instruments, valves, and devices.
- Accurately and to a high level of quality assemble threaded Stainless-steel pipe spools including instruments, valves, and devices.
- Safely, and with a high level of comfort and accuracy use hand tools and small machine equipment. Including but not limited to;
- Hand drills for use in carbon and stainless-steel drilling and tapping.
- Angle grinders for both cutting and grinding
- Pipe cutter/threader
- Drill press/Mill
- Miter saw – for PVC or wood
- Concrete drill – Impact/coring
- Transit/shovel/rake/level
- Safely, and with a high level of comfort climb ladders into and out of tanks or onto structures
- Understanding of required safety devices
- Walk over uneven ground carrying loads that may exceed 50lbs
